AI summary

Cravatex Ltd reported Q2 FY26 standalone revenue from operations of ₹252.58 lakhs vs ₹225.83 lakhs YoY, but standalone profit after tax plunged to ₹33.02 lakhs from ₹210.51 lakhs due to a sharp drop in other income (₹125.56 lakhs vs ₹345.64 lakhs). On a consolidated basis, Q2 FY26 revenue from operations fell to ₹5,144.52 lakhs from ₹5,503.62 lakhs YoY, but consolidated PAT attributable to owners jumped to ₹521.60 lakhs from ₹265.02 lakhs. For H1 FY26, consolidated revenue declined to ₹7,457.21 lakhs vs ₹8,081.22 lakhs, while consolidated PAT rose modestly to ₹384.83 lakhs from ₹313.40 lakhs. The wholly-owned UK subsidiary BB (UK) Ltd and step-down subsidiary BB Euro GmbH together posted a net loss of ₹307.62 lakhs for the period. Operating cash flow was negative at both standalone (-₹268.55 lakhs) and consolidated (-₹930.91 lakhs) levels in H1 FY26. The statutory auditors issued an unmodified limited review opinion.
